Is pwSafe free?

Password Safe is a free and open-source password manager program originally written for Microsoft Windows but supporting wide area of operating systems with compatible clients available for Linux, FreeBSD, Android, IOS, BlackBerry and other operating systems as well.

How do you use pwSafe?

Using Password Safe

  1. Open the web site or service to which you need to log in.
  2. Place the cursor in the form’s “Username:” field.
  3. Open Password Safe, and then select a passphrase entry.
  4. Click Perform Autotype in the toolbar.

What are safe passwords?

Password Safe allows users to store all passwords in a single “safe” (password database), or to create multiple databases for different purposes (e.g., one for work, one for personal use). … Afterwards, you will be prompted to enter a master password that is used to encrypt and lock the contents of your new safe.

What are the disadvantages of a password manager?

Single point of failure – if someone gets hold of your master password, they have all your passwords. Password manager programs are a target for hackers. It’s not easy to login using multiple devices.
